Hand-woven ilala palm with a natural rim.

Displaying exceptional structural balance, this medium, bowl-shaped basket is patiently hand-woven by the Masvingo Women Weavers in Zimbabwe. The design features a crisp outer border of interlocking, harlequin-style diamonds that encircle the piece like a patterned ribbon. This repetitive, dark geometric frame leaves a generous center of un-dyed, sun-kissed natural fiber to take center stage around the prominent square rosette, all beautifully finished with a clean, un-dyed woven rim.

Every element connects back to the landscape. Handcrafted from sustainably gathered ilala palm leaves, wild grasses, and reeds, the rich, charcoal-brown tones of the pattern are achieved through a slow, traditional dyeing process using local tree bark and roots. Shaped by human hands rather than a mold, its slight organic variations make it completely unique.
